Output 409130f137a29a5fa198cef51d4414e52f2428a614bce8984e0c92ec83ed691f:61

value
15929446
script pubkey
OP_0 OP_PUSHBYTES_32 e1c96e449c4bbb12f6a1c3ba45542a42cb2d94116640f4f17f0a75a587cb0f2d
address
bc1qu8yku3yufwa39a4pcway24p2gt9jm9q3veq0futlpf66tp7tpuks038mle
transaction
409130f137a29a5fa198cef51d4414e52f2428a614bce8984e0c92ec83ed691f